Jordan Romero knocked home the go-ahead run with a pinch-hit single in the 14th inning as LSU beat Florida 5-3 in a Southeastern Conference Tournament marathon that ended early Thursday morning.  The game lasted just over 5 hours, making it the longest game in SEC Tournament history in terms of time.

The game didn't end until close to 1:30 Thursday morning.

LSU (41-17) next takes on Mississippi State (41-14-1), which beat Alabama 4-1 on Wednesday. Florida (44-12) faces Alabama (32-25) in an elimination game.
